Abstract
Air pollution is one of the governing factor for the public health and it is the concerning part for the environment. The main objective of this paper is to provide the details about our project which is based on monitoring the air quality index of area where we live. This will help us to know in what situation we are living and what are the environmental changes that need to be made to make our live more healthy. In this paper we will show how our project compares the actual data with the predefined data. The predefined data is based on the National Air Quality Index (NQAI). In this paper concentration of various pollutants along with various harmful gases for various cities of India are also analyzed based on NAQI data and it will be easy to compare the actual data with it. This paper includes the comparison data of many Indian cities with grown alarming due to severe unsafe web of particulate matter (PM) and harmful gases present in air.
